Master the Techniques of Cleaning and Daily Care for Encaustic Tiles

Choosing Gentle Cleaning Products to Safeguard Your Tiles
Original Victorian tiles are especially sensitive to aggressive cleaning agents. Common household cleaners, such as bleach and vinegar, can strip colour and inflict lasting damage. Opting for a pH-neutral cleaning solution is the safest route, as it effectively lifts grime without harming the tile's glaze or the underlying subfloor. This careful methodology allows you to clean your tiles with assurance, alleviating concerns about damaging these irreplaceable pieces while ensuring their heritage is preserved for generations to come.
Utilising Suitable Tools to Maintain Tile Integrity
When caring for your tiles, it is vital to employ soft brushes or microfiber cloths rather than abrasive scrubbing pads. Aggressive scrubbing can scratch the tile surface, making future cleaning more challenging. Using a vacuum cleaner with a gentle floor attachment can help eliminate dirt and grit before mopping, which is essential to maintaining the integrity of your flooring. This proactive strategy diminishes scratches and wear, allowing your tiles to remain stunning for extended periods.
Establishing Effective Cleaning Routines for High-Traffic Zones
In busy hallways, it is crucial to sweep or vacuum daily to remove grit tracked in from outside. In kitchens, promptly wiping up spills prevents staining and helps maintain a pristine appearance. Likewise, in bathrooms, drying tiles after use can reduce the risk of watermarks. These small yet impactful habits significantly decrease the likelihood of staining and dullness. Steering Clear of Common Mistakes in the Care of Victorian Tiles

Steer Clear of Household Cleaners That Damage Your Tiles
While it may seem convenient to use common cleaning products on your Victorian tiles, many can cause more harm than good. Substances like vinegar, bleach, and harsh detergents can strip colour, create a cloudy haze, or etch the delicate surface. By avoiding these damaging products, you significantly reduce the risk of permanent harm, allowing your floors to maintain their authentic character and aesthetic appeal.

Re-Grouting and Sealing for Maximum Protection
Replacing damaged or missing grout is essential for stabilising the floor and preventing moisture-related problems. After cleaning, tiles are sealed with breathable products that guard against stains while allowing the material to release moisture naturally. This method ensures that your Victorian tile restoration is not merely cosmetic; it also improves structural integrity and promotes long-lasting durability.

Insights for Continued Maintenance and Aftercare
Formulating Weekly Routines for Busy Households
Once your Victorian tiles have received professional restoration, maintaining their condition does not necessitate extensive effort. A quick weekly mop using a pH-neutral solution can efficiently remove dust and light marks without harming the glaze. In hallways, vacuuming with a soft-bristle attachment can assist in preventing grit from scratching the surface. This approach reduces upkeep stress and provides you with greater confidence that your floors will remain elegant with minimal effort involved.
Arranging Annual Inspections and Resealing for Longevity
Even with diligent daily cleaning, heritage tiles benefit from professional attention on an annual basis. Regular inspections can detect early signs of wear, staining, or sealant failure. Most Surrey homes require resealing every two to three years, depending on foot traffic levels.
